Abstract: Comparison geometry is a significant topic in metric geometry and geometric analysis. Gromov proposes to study comparison theorems related to scalar curvature and mean curvature for manifolds with boundary. In this talk, I will summarize recent developments on this topic, utilizing tools from index theory and geometric analysis. I will also talk about our recent work, joint with Zhichao Wang and Bo Zhu, where we prove a scalar-mean rigidity theorem using capillary mu-bubbles.
